As Jaybee says, there's more examples of how you can use styled lists at Listamatic than you can shake a stick at! Using images for navigation, especially if it's just a simple list is rarely a good idea - much better for SEO and accessibility to use text and syle it with CSS. If you're using a tables layout you could put your text in the large table cell and set your image as a background image. If you're learning CSS and switching to a CSS layout you can either position a div with your nav over the photo, or keep your nav and image in the same div and position your text with appropriate margins and padding.
